That's the point of these videos. Using a plugin and listening to what it does is just one part of the video. Another aspect is whether the claims and price tag attached to it are worth it. Maag eq4 from Plugin Alliance is available for 29-39$ in any sale (which happens many times every year). Slate Fresh Air is absolutely free. Any stock eq with an adjustable high shelf, along with a decent saturation plugin (Softube Saturation Knob is a free one) will give you the desired effect at a much lower price point. The point of the video is that if you understand how something is being done, you can probably save some money by doing the same thing with tools already available to you and use that money for something that is actually worth it.

@Beatsbasteln Жыл бұрын
The price of this plugin is just ridiculous. Whoever decided to sell a bit of highshelf-saturation for more than 20€ has lost their mind. i wouldn't even say that the plugin sounds bad or that every nonlinear plugin desperately needs oversampling, because as you noticed yourself, it sounds good. but there's nothing complicated going on dsp-wise and no unique idea as claimed on the website. it just seems like a nice little convenience tool, just like bertom air shelf. actually would be interesting to see how these 2 plugins compare, since bertom has earned a great reputation already, but hasn't got a very "commercial appearance" yet
